Before you hitch up, make sure your tow vehicle has the correct hitch receiver for the trailer's tongue size, typically a 2-inch or 1.25-inch Class II or Class III hitch. Check that your vehicle's towing capacity meets or exceeds the trailer's dry weight plus your load. Confirm your hitch ball, coupler, and safety chains are in good condition. If the trailer uses electric brakes or lights, verify your vehicle's wiring matches the trailer's plug type, usually a 4-pin or 7-pin connector. Most owners in Springville will walk you through the basics, but it's smart to do a quick walk-around inspection with them, checking tire pressure, lights, and latch security. Take photos of the trailer's condition before you leave to protect yourself.


Springville trailer rental rates vary by trailer type and how long you need it. Small utility trailers typically run 40 to 60 dollars per day, while larger utility trailers and car haulers range from 60 to 150 dollars daily depending on size and features. Dump trailers usually cost 100 to 180 dollars per day. Many owners offer weekly discounts, so if you're renting for several days, ask about that savings.
